The formula

°C = K − 273.15

Kelvin is the SI base unit of temperature, used in physics and chemistry — it starts at absolute zero.

Celsius is used worldwide for everyday temperature — weather, cooking, and science.

Worked examples

273.15 K0 °CFreezing point of water

Apply K − 273.15 with input = 273.15. Result: 0 °C.

373.15 K100 °CBoiling point of water

Apply K − 273.15 with input = 373.15. Result: 100 °C.

0 K-273.15 °CAbsolute zero

Apply K − 273.15 with input = 0. Result: -273.15 °C.

310 K36.85 °CHuman body temperature

Apply K − 273.15 with input = 310. Result: 36.85 °C.
